With support from the Kavli Foundation, the Vice Presidents of the American Astronomical Society (AAS) name a special invited lecturer to kick off each semiannual AAS meeting with a presentation on recent research of great importance. At the 241st AAS meeting in Seattle, Washington, on 9 January 2023, the Fred Kavli Plenary Lecture will be given by Dr. Jane Rigby, an astrophysicist at NASA's Goddard Space Flight Center and Project Scientist for Operations for the James Webb Space Telescope (JWST).
